Solution Mining Guide

Conventional solution mining, also known as In Situ Leaching (ISL), refers to the artificial extraction of raw material, by pumping superheated water into deposits.The targeted minerals are dissolved, and the brine is pumped to the surface where it is cooled down, dried, and processed. Mining versus in-situ: A look at how energy companies are …

As a result, the split between bitumen mining and in-situ bitumen extraction has dramatically shifted over the past 5 years. View fullsize. see live chart → Since 1999, bitumen extraction from mining operations has grown 245%. However, thermal in-situ extraction has expanded by over 500%.

The Time Duration of the Effects of Total Extraction Mining …

Since the 1990s, remote sensing data have been available to monitor the surface movement for long periods of time. The analysis of satellite data shows that there is still residual subsidence (i.e., with average rates of about −10 mm/year) several decades after mining longwall panels in an area.
